What You Gain From Listing with Google Local Business Center

Google Local Searches – Business Listing

With Google as the search engine giant, it’s in your best interest to make it as easy as possible for Google to let Google know more about you and your business. One of the easiest ways to do this is by submitting your local business to Google Local Business Center. After doing so, you can begin to see immediate results such as:

  • Google will give your site more authority because they know it is a real business, giving you better search engine ranking for your keywords.
  • Add your website to Google Maps so potential customers can instantly find out more about you. One of the hottest new ways to find local businesses right now is through Google Maps.
  • Insert specific keywords into your business description. For example if you’re a financial planner, you can add retirement specialist, wealth management, annuity specialist, etc. to your title. This will give you a leg up on those who just have their name.
  • Better control the information including name, phone, number, address, and hours of operation.
  • Add any certifications you have next to your name. For example, you could be listed as John Smith CPA.
  • Google allows you to see how customers are finding you via Google Dashboard. For example, you’re able to know if a customer came from Google Maps of Google Search and the keywords that were typed in. This will allow you to optimize your marketing efforts.
  • Add a picture of your office, which will appear in Google Maps, so new customers can identify your building. This will make it easier for customers to find you.
  • Allows customers to review and rate your services.
  • It has an infinite ROI because it’s free!

It wouldn’t take you more than 15 minutes to sign your local business up for an account, so don’t miss a chance.
